| [Note Guidelines] Photographer's Note |
On a walk today with my daughters, I was looking for a macro shot, but one daughter told me to look above our heads. She had discovered that we were totally shielded by a canopy of tulip poplars. This area in Maryland is known for its abundance of the species, and since many here are nearing the end of their typical fifty-year lifespan, recent storms have brought several down.
PP work--only a slight crop to maximize symmetry, and an increase in saturation (+33). |
